Jean-Denis "JD" Grèze is the Co-Founder and CEO of Town, the AI work assistant reportedly in talks to raise funding at a $1BN valuation. Before founding Town, JD spent seven years as CTO of Plaid. Before Plaid, he was Director of Engineering at Dropbox. He is also a prolific angel investor backing companies including Modal, BaseTen, Merge and NexHealth.
